facebook twitter hatena line email

「Unity/Csharp/enum」の版間の差分

提供: 初心者エンジニアの簡易メモ
移動: 案内検索
(enumのforeachサンプル)
(enumのforeachサンプル)
行7: 行7:
 
}
 
}
 
</pre>
 
</pre>
==enumのforeachサンプル==
+
==enumのforeach記述==
 
<pre>
 
<pre>
 
foreach (HogeType hogeType in Enum.GetValues(typeof(HogeType)))
 
foreach (HogeType hogeType in Enum.GetValues(typeof(HogeType)))

2021年12月3日 (金) 14:11時点における版

宣言

public enum HogeType
{
    PIYO,
    FUGA
}

enumのforeach記述

foreach (HogeType hogeType in Enum.GetValues(typeof(HogeType)))
{
    string name = Enum.GetName(typeof(HogeType), hogeType);
}